Way #1

1. Don't forget hashtags!

Monetizing Tumblr without proper hashtag etiquette will be really, really difficult. Tagging on Tumblr allows your post to spread and be shared, plus it helps you keep your content organized.

Tip: A popular technique these days is to hashtag your reactions to content. For example, for a funny post, use #lol or something similar. This will ensure you get more eyes on your content.

Way #3

3. Follow, follow, follow

If you're really serious about monetizing your Tumblr and getting a huge following, it's super important to remember to follow other users in your sphere of influence. If they follow you first, then follow them back ASAP!

Note: It's not enough simply to follow. You should be interacting with other influencers on the platform, too.
